TM  9-2330-359-14&P 2-16.   CAGING   AND   UNCAGING   SPRING   BRAKES   (M872   AND   M872A3)   (Con’t). (2) Remove cap (1) from access hole (6), (3)   Remove   nut   (2),   washer   (3),   and release stud (5) from airbrake chamber (4). (4)  Insert  tab  end  of  release  stud  (5)  in access hole (6) and turn release stud 1/4 turn clockwise. (5) Install washer (3) and nut (2) on release stud (5). Tighten nut until spring is fully caged. (6) Repeat steps 2 through 5 for remaining spring  brake  chambers. (7)  Remove  wheel  chocks  and  stow. (8) road. (9) Move semitrailer off travelled portion of Chock  semitrailer  wheels. Notify organizational maintenance. (10) b. Uncaging  Spring  Brakes. WARNING Chock  wheels  to  prevent  semitrailer  from  moving  when  brakes  are  released  (caged). Failure to follow this warning may result in serious injury or death. (1) Remove nut (2) and washer (3) from release stud (5). (2) Remove release stud (5) from access hole (6), (3) Install release stud (5) on airbrake chamber (4) with washer (3) and nut (2). (4)  Install  cap  (1)  on  access  hole  (6). (5) Repeat steps 1 through 4 for remaining spring brake chambers. (6)  Remove  and  stow  chocks. 2-17.   FOLDING   TARPAULIN. CAUTION a. b. c. d. e. f . Do not fold or stow tarpaulin when wet or dirty. Failure to follow this caution may result In damage to tarpaulin. Lay tarpaulin on a flat, clean surface. Fold top and bottom ends of tarpaulin to the middle. Lay ropes straight. Fold both sides of tarpaulin to the middle. Lay ropes straight. Fold tarpaulin in half. NOTE The ropes are used to secure tarpaulin when it Is folded. Ensure that all air has been released by pressing or kneeling on folded tarpaulin. Fold tarpaulin in half again and secure with ropes. Stow tarpaulin in stowage box (para 1-7). TA507993 2-19
